hi, I recently bought molot Vepr 1V 5.56×45 VPO 155 with 16 inch barrel.it is semi automatic. In my country i have the legal right to keep a fully automatic rifle. my question is, is it technically safe to convert this rifle into a fully automatic rifle?
 
I am not familiar with that particular rifle, but ...

Such a conversion for a locking-bolt (as opposed to open-bolt, like a submachine gun) rifle would only be safe with a positive Auto Sear mechanism included. The auto sear linkage guarantees that the hammer cannot drop until/unless the breech is closed.

An example of incorporated but unused auto sear linkage in a semi-auto can be seen in the Soviet SVT-40 rifles. For those rifles to be fired the (tilting) bolt presses down on a "button" in the receiver that unlocks the trigger pack.
